BC rapper Sirreal releases new album In The Nick of Time

BC rapper Sirreal releases new album In The Nick of Time

Quality takes time. Most things happen when they are supposed to, often right when we need them to or, In The Nick of Time.

The new 13-track offering from Sirreal refreshingly serves up his concepts of accepting the dark to appreciate the light and finding balance in the nick of time with equal reality.

Produced by Rob the Viking from Swollen Members, Sirreal layers many different outlooks on his path of resilience over perfectly timed beats from engineer, Rob The Viking and Anno Domini.

Featuring guest verses from rising star Junk to rap legend Gift of Gab of Blackalicious and even Sirreal’s own 9-year-old son Lower Case g, this album has something for everyone.

It’s time to bring some light back into peoples lives, this is a great place to start.

You can find In The Nick of Time on Spotify, iTunes, and other digital outlets.
